Common Issues with Patio Doors
Regardless of their toughness, patio doors can face various problems that need attention. Here are a few of the most common issues:
Leaking or Drafting
- Cause: Gaps in the door frame, worn weatherstripping, or a misaligned door.
- Service: Replace weatherstripping, change the door alignment, or seal gaps with caulk.
Trouble in Opening or Closing
- Cause: Misaligned tracks, debris in the tracks, or used rollers.
- Option: Clean the tracks, straighten the door, or replace the rollers.
Misting or Condensation Between Glass Panes
- Cause: Broken seal on the insulated glass unit.
- Solution: Replace the glass unit.
Cracked or Broken Glass
- Cause: Impact from external things or age-related wear.
- Solution: Replace the glass panel.
Faulty Locking Mechanisms
- Cause: Wear and tear, deterioration, or damage.
- Service: Lubricate the lock, replace used parts, or install a new lock.
Distorted or Damaged Frame
- Trigger: Exposure to wetness, temperature level fluctuations, or physical damage.
- Option: Repair or replace the damaged sections of the frame.

Frequently Asked Questions About Local Patio Door Repairs
Q: How typically should I have my patio door examined for potential concerns?
- A: It is advised to inspect your patio door at least as soon as a year. Routine assessments can assist identify and deal with minor problems before they become major issues.
Q: Can I repair a patio door myself, or should I work with an expert?
- A: While some small concerns can be resolved with DIY services, more complex problems must be dealt with by a professional. Inaccurate repairs can cause further damage and security dangers.
Q: What should I do if my patio door is dripping?
- A: First, check for gaps in the door frame and replace any worn weatherstripping. If the issue persists, it may signify a more severe problem, such as a misaligned door or a damaged frame, which need to be attended to by a professional.
Q: How can I avoid fogging between the glass panes of my patio door?
- A: Fogging is frequently a sign of a damaged seal on the insulated glass unit. To prevent Patio Door Weatherstripping Repair , ensure the door is effectively sealed and maintain a constant indoor temperature level. If misting occurs, the glass unit will need to be replaced.
Q: What are the signs that my patio door requires to be replaced instead of fixed?
- A: If the door is substantially distorted, the frame is badly damaged, or the door no longer offers adequate insulation or security, it may be time to consider a replacement. A professional can examine the condition of your door and provide recommendations.
